ULN2003ADRG3 Equivalent & Substitute Parts

Part Overview

The ULN2003ADRG3 is a 7-channel NPN Darlington power switch/driver manufactured by Texas Instruments, designed for relay and solenoid driving applications. This part operates at a maximum load voltage of 50V with 500mA output current per channel and features a 1:1 input-to-output ratio with low-side output configuration. The ULN2003ADRG3 is currently in Last Time Buy status, indicating production discontinuation. Identifying equivalent and substitute parts is necessary to ensure design continuity and maintain supply chain reliability for new production runs and long-term support.

Substitute Part Grouping Explanation

Substitution eligibility for the ULN2003ADRG3 is determined by the following critical parameters:

  • Number of Outputs: Must be 7 channels
  • Output Type: Darlington or NPN configuration
  • Voltage - Load (Max): Minimum 50V rating
  • Current - Output (Max): Minimum 500mA per channel
  • Ratio - Input:Output: 1:1 configuration
  • Output Configuration: Low Side
  • Input Type: Inverting
  • Package / Case: 16-SOIC form factor (0.154", 3.90mm Width)
  • Mounting Type: Surface Mount
  • RoHS Status: ROHS3 Compliant

Substitute parts are grouped into two categories: direct equivalents (same base product number ULN2003 with different packaging or manufacturer) and functional upgrades (ULN2004 series and ULQ variants that meet or exceed all electrical specifications while maintaining pin compatibility and package form factor).

Engineering Selection Recommendations

Direct Equivalent (Recommended Primary Substitute):

ULN2003ADR (Texas Instruments) is the primary recommended substitute. This part maintains identical electrical specifications, Darlington output type, and 16-SOIC package form factor as the ULN2003ADRG3. The only difference is packaging format (Cut Tape & Digi-Reel® versus Tape & Reel), which does not affect functional compatibility. Product status is Active with significantly higher inventory availability (1,005,200 units), ensuring long-term supply continuity.

Secondary Equivalent (Same Base Product, Alternative Manufacturer):

ULN2003D1013TR (STMicroelectronics) provides functional equivalence with extended operating temperature range (-40°C to 85°C versus -40°C to 70°C). This part is suitable for applications requiring higher temperature tolerance. Inventory availability is excellent (1,787,200 units), and product status is Active.

Functional Upgrade Options:

ULQ2003ADR2G (onsemi) and ULQ2003D1013TR (STMicroelectronics) are functionally compatible upgrades maintaining Darlington output type with extended operating temperature ranges. These parts are categorized as Transistors, Bipolar (BJT) and support identical electrical load specifications.

ULN2004 series parts (ULN2004AS16-13 and ULN2004D1013TR) feature NPN output type instead of Darlington configuration. These parts meet all voltage and current specifications and support extended operating temperature ranges (-40°C to 105°C and -40°C to 85°C respectively). Selection of NPN variants requires circuit-level verification to confirm compatibility with existing input drive requirements.

ULQ2003D1013TRY (STMicroelectronics) includes automotive qualification (AEC-Q100) and is suitable for automotive applications requiring enhanced reliability certification.

All substitute parts maintain ROHS3 compliance and are suitable for direct PCB layout substitution without modification.

Frequently Asked Questions (FAQ)

Q: Can I use ULN2004 series parts as substitutes for ULN2003ADRG3?

A: ULN2004 series parts (ULN2004AS16-13 and ULN2004D1013TR) meet all electrical specifications and package requirements. The primary difference is output type: ULN2004 uses NPN configuration while ULN2003 uses Darlington. Both configurations support 50V load voltage and 500mA output current. Circuit compatibility depends on input drive voltage and impedance requirements specific to your application.

Q: What is the difference between Tape & Reel and Cut Tape packaging?

A: Tape & Reel (TR) packaging supplies components on continuous tape suitable for high-volume automated assembly. Cut Tape (CT) & Digi-Reel® packaging provides smaller quantities on tape segments. Both formats contain identical components and are functionally equivalent. Selection depends on production volume and assembly equipment compatibility.

Q: Are all substitute parts pin-compatible with ULN2003ADRG3?

A: All listed substitute parts maintain 16-SOIC package form factor with identical pin assignments. Direct PCB substitution is supported without layout modification.

Q: Which substitute offers the best long-term availability?

A: ULN2003ADR (Texas Instruments) and ULN2003D1013TR (STMicroelectronics) offer the highest inventory levels (1,005,200 and 1,787,200 units respectively) with Active product status, ensuring sustained supply chain support.

Q: Can I use ULQ2003D1013TRY in non-automotive applications?

A: ULQ2003D1013TRY includes AEC-Q100 automotive qualification and MSL-3 moisture sensitivity rating. This part is functionally suitable for non-automotive applications; however, the automotive qualification and enhanced reliability specifications represent design margin beyond standard requirements.

Q: What operating temperature range should I select?

A: The ULN2003ADRG3 operates at -40°C to 70°C. Substitute parts offer extended ranges: ULN2003D1013TR and ULQ2003ADR2G support -40°C to 85°C, while ULN2004AS16-13 supports -40°C to 105°C. Select based on your application's thermal environment requirements.
